OBS

[Gastropods of the] family Helicinidae [are] land snails of small to medium size, few-whorled, conical to lenticular; [the] inner walls of [the] whorls [are] resorbed; [the] umbilicus [is] mostly concealed by [a] columellar lip or filled with a callus pad; [the] operculum [is] semicircular to rhombic, without apophyses, horny nearly always reinforced exteriorly by a calcareous layer. [They have a] pulmonary cavity and no ctenidium. "U. Cret.-Rec. ".

OBS

[Les Gastéropodes de la] famille des Helicinidae [sont des] rhipidoglosses comme les néritidés, auxquels ils ressemblent, ils se rattachent plutôt aux néritopsidés par leur opercule dépourvu d'apophyses, mais leurs tours internes sont résorbés. [Le] test [est] lisse, [l']ouverture bordée (...). Ce sont des pulmonés vivant sur les arbres.
